Excerpt from The Story of the Plants And to glide gently over the distinction between hydro-carbons and carbo-hydrates; which could interest none but chemical students. I have been well content to make these trivial sacrifices of formal accuracy in order to find room for fuller exposition of the delightful relations between flowers and insects, birds and fruits, soil and plant, climate and foliage. In one word, I have dwelt more on the functions and habits of plants than on their structure and classification. Excerpt from The First Book of Plants Plants grow almost everywhere in the world around us in all sizes and shapes. Some are so small that they can be seen only with a microscope. Others, like the redwood trees of Cali lornia, tower high in the sky. Plants grow not only in well watered soil, but in oceans, rivers, lakes and swamps, in deserts, on rocks, far above the ground on branches of trees, on old pieces of wood, even on such unlikely things as crusts of bread, old shoes, or on top of arctic snow. Some strange plants eat insects, and others steal food from their neighbors. Plants and animals are the living, growing things of the earth. Most animals move around, and many of them have sound apparatuses, for making noises. Most plants spend their whole lives silently in one place. Because they live so quietly, we sometimes forget that during their growing seasons they work hard all day long. For plants are just as alive as animals, and they have the same problems: finding and keeping a place to live, getting food, fighting animal enemies and plant rivals. First Studies of Plant Life is written with a truly heart-warming purpose. Written by a distinguished academic but pitched at a level which is designed to allow a teacher to captivate a child in the earliest years of school. Atkinson takes the view that reasoning and 'why?' questions are suitable and appropriate for even the tiniest children and should not be held in reserve for a later date. It centres on an understanding of the 'life history' of a plant rather than tedious and traditional encouragements to rote learn and exclude context. George Francis Atkinson tells us in a startling modern way that a child does not best learn about a flower by uprooting it, dissecting and classifying it. Rather they should plant a seed, find out how it germinates, watch it grow, learn about its food, see how it breathes, reproduces and ultimately dies back. For as the author states 'When the child has once become acquainted with the conditions and necessities of plant life, how different will the world seem to him.' The book begins and progresses in an intuitive way. It begins with the particular characteristics of seeds and their peculiarities and progresses all the way on to the root systems, the changing colours of the leaves on trees and the bright momentary flowers and bids by plants for pollination and reproduction. Small engaging experiments suitable for independent learners, homeschooling or teachers in a classroom are outlined and encouraged, further tying the book to an inclusive ethos of hands on learning. A child could hardly fail to fall in love with botany when taught from this book but an adult has scarcely more opportunity to avoid being enthralled. Excerpt from Plant Relations: A First Book of Botany 1. General relations - Plants form the natural covering of the earth's surface. So generally is this true that a land surface without plants seems remarkable. Not only do plants cover the land, but they abound in waters as well, both fresh and salt waters. They are wonderfully varied in size, ranging from huge trees to forms so minute that the microscope must be used to discover them. They are also exceedingly variable in form, as may be seen by comparing trees, lilies, ferns, mosses, mushrooms, lichens, and the green thready growths (algae) found in water. Excerpt from The Study of Plant Life As a result of the present efforts to raise the standard of education in this country, many different Methods of Teaching are receiving our grave consideration. So insistent are their advocates, that we stand in some danger of forgetting that learning. Rather than teaching, is the essential factor in education. It is not the know ledge given us ready-made by the teacher, but that which we learn, acquiring it by our own efforts, which enters into our being and becomes a lasting possession. Therefore this little book does not pretend so much to teach as to act as a guide along the road for those who desire to learn something about the plants around them; hence it points out how much they can easily see for themselves of the wonderful life and work of the silent plants. It is planned for children, whose quick sympathies are more readily drawn towards the life of things than to the dry facts of morphology or classification. Its Leitmotif is therefore the story of life, and those of its activities which find expression in the plant world. Perhaps it may serve to awaken interest in some older people who have not yet been initiated into these mysteries. As is inevitable, most of the actual facts in this book are already the common property of botanists, though some of the suggested work, such as the mapping, is only now being adopted by the Universities.
